COLUMBUS, OH, January 23,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a recognized creator of innovative television series, happily announces its most recent documentary series, "New Frontiers," showcasing the revolutionary achievements of Andelyn Biosciences. This documentary will explore the new strides made by Andelyn Biosciences, a leading g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the dynamic space of biotechnology.

"New Frontiers" is a compelling series thoroughly created to explore innovative businesses that are at the forefront of framing the foreseeable future of healthcare across the world.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and available on on-demand by means of various streaming plat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Through the elaborate space of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has blossomed as a innovator, progressing innovative therapies and contributing significantly to the biopharmaceutical arena. Established in 2020, the firm, based in Columbus, Ohio, originated out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ute together with a project to speeding up the progression and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Key Focus Areas:

Cell and Gene Therapies: Andelyn Biosciences specializes in the progression and manufacturing of cell and gene therapies, genetically engineering treatment procedures or cures for target diseases such as genetic disorders, cancer, and autoimmune conditions.

Bioprocessing and Manufacturing: Andelyn exceeds expectation in bioprocessing and manufacturing technologies, assuring the cost-effective and scalable production of gene therapies.

Genetic Carriers

Pathogens have adapted to efficiently transport DNA sequences into target cells, establishing them as a viable method for DNA-based treatment. Common viral vectors include:

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both mitotic and static cells but may provoke immune responses.

Parvovirus-based carriers – Preferred due to their reduced immune response and ability to sustain long-term DNA transcription.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Integrate into the cellular DNA,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viral vectors being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.

Synthetic Gene Transport Mechanisms

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These encompass:

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Encapsulating genetic sequences for efficient intracellular transport.

Electroporation –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in plasma barriers,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.

Targeted Genetic Infusion –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Understanding the Biological Foundations of Cell and Gene Therapies

Cellular Treatments: The Power of Live Cell Applications

Tissue restoration techniques harnesses the restoration capabilities of cells to address health conditions. Significant therapies comprise:

Regenerative Blood Cell Therapy:
Used to address malignancies and blood-related diseases through regenerative transplantation by integrating functional cell have a peek here lines.

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Therapy: A game-changing tumor-targeting approach in which a individual’s immune cells are engineered to eliminate and eliminate neoplastic cells.

Multipotent Stromal Cell Therapy: Researched for its therapeutic value in managing immune system disorders, structural impairments, and neurodegenerative disorders.

DNA-Based Therapy: Transforming the Genetic Blueprint

Gene therapy achieves results by altering the root cause of DNA-related illnesses:

In Vivo Gene Therapy: Injects genetic material immediately within the patient’s body, for example the FDA-approved vision-restoring Luxturna for curing genetic eye conditions.

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Requires editing a individual’s tissues outside the system and then reintroducing them, as applied in some clinical trials for hemoglobinopathy conditions and immune deficiencies.

The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has greatly enhanced gene therapy clinical trials, making possible precise modifications at the genetic scale.

Revolutionary Impacts in Biomedicine

Cell and gene therapies are redefining healthcare models in different branches:

Malignancy Combat Strategies

The approval of CAR-T cell therapies like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the landscape of cancer treatment, particularly for cancer sufferers with refractory hematologic diseases who have exhausted other options.

Genomic Syndromes

Disorders including spinal muscular atrophy along with SCD, that until recently had limited intervention methods, as of today have promising genomic medicine strategies including Zolgensma alongside a cutting-edge genetic correction method.
